Gets the input scope of the current control in the enumeration.
public:
void InputScopes(IntPtr ppInputScopes, [Runtime::InteropServices::Out] System::UInt32 % pcInputScopes, [Runtime::InteropServices::Out] Microsoft::Office::Interop::InfoPath::IEnumString ^ % ppenumPhraseList, [Runtime::InteropServices::Out] System::String ^ % pbstrRegExp);
public void InputScopes (IntPtr ppInputScopes, out uint pcInputScopes, out Microsoft.Office.Interop.InfoPath.IEnumString ppenumPhraseList, out string pbstrRegExp);
abstract member InputScopes : nativeint * * * -> unit
Public Sub InputScopes (ppInputScopes As IntPtr, ByRef pcInputScopes As UInteger, ByRef ppenumPhraseList As IEnumString, ByRef pbstrRegExp As String)
Parameters
- ppInputScopes
-
IntPtr
nativeint
Pointer to an array of input scopes.
- pcInputScopes
- UInt32
The number of input scopes in the array pointed to by ppInputScopes
.
- ppenumPhraseList
- IEnumString
Pointer to an implementation of the IEnumString interface containing the phrase list.
- pbstrRegExp
- String
Pointer to a string containing the regular expression to be recognized.
Remarks
For information about how input scopes are defined for controls in InfoPath forms, search InfoPath help for "Input scopes for InfoPath controls".
For a list of controls that are enumerated in the view, if present, see the GetControls(IEnumUnknown) method of the IInfoPathDataImporterFields interface.
